Harry Hill
Funny and completely off his rocker! Had a series that concentrated heavily on the dillusion that there would be a Badger Parade- the most famous of these badgers probably being Gareth Southgate Badger!

The show "Harry Hill" survived 3 series' (1997-2000) and involved various characters (inc. the badgers). Comedian Al Murray player his Big- Brother Alan, there was of course the hairy guy from the Joy of Sex books and Burt Kwouk- whom I remember singing at one point... "Hey Little Hen, When, When, When, will you lay me an egg for my tea?..." Also had a regular cat... Stouffer! In this series also and in some of his live acts he would rhyme things together as a memory system also as accordance as what they should eat inc. Quiche Lorraine/ Great Dane although Cheddar Cheese/ Pekinese was not an accepted format!

Then came the series Harry Hill's TV Burp, which essentially was his views of programs for the week with lots of satire and a lil' parody. This series included a fight before the break- I remember one such being between a Red Nose and Pudsy (sp?) the Bear (Children In Need).

And there was a series of 'The All New Harry Hill Show' in 2003
